Policies PWT’s sustainability work is based on the UN Global Compact’s ten principles and follows the approach set forth in the OECD Guidelines for Multinational Enter- prises and the UN Guiding Principles on Business and Human Rights (UNGP’s) The Group’s CSR Policy refers to internationally endorsed principles for sustainable development, such as the International Bill of Human Rights, including core ILO labour rights, the Rio Declara- tion and the UN Convention against Corruption. Internal Processes PWT sets the same requirements for itself as to its sup- pliers: • Adopt policies • Conduct regular risk assessments • Draw up action plans to manage identified risks and challenges • Communication about actions and results • Enable access to remedy through a legitimate grievance mechanism This is a process which requires both time and resour- ces and the Group is continuously improving its due dili- gence procedures. The strategy is integrated in all departments of the com- pany, such as Design, Purchase, Sales, Marketing and Retail through info meetings, communication materials, etc. On a quarterly basis, ESG meetings are held with the management group and the Group has in 2024 in- troduced a project group which will be responsible for implementing projects across the organization. Partnerships PWT strives to encourage cooperation and dialogue with suppliers and other relevant parties on social, environ- mentally, and economically sustainable solutions. Tack- ling global and wide-spread risks cannot be achieved by one company alone, and the Group collaborates with several organisations and initiatives to create as much positive impact as possible. The Group sees it as imperative that the different play- ers of the textile industry come together to create the most valuable and long-lasting changes that are need- ed. PWT work closely together with Danish organisa- tions and assert our influence regarding coming legi- slations. The Group is also proud to cooperate with Plastic Change, the Danish environmental organisation that works to break the exponential growth of plastic pol- lution.
